What is Archer Aviation?

Alright, so first things first: what exactly is Archer Aviation? In a nutshell, Archer is an aviation company dedicated to designing, manufacturing, and operating eVTOL aircraft designed to transport passengers in urban environments. They're not just dreaming up futuristic concepts; they're actively working to build and deploy these aircraft, with the goal of providing a safe, sustainable, and efficient way to travel within cities. The company was founded with the vision of making urban air mobility a practical reality, aiming to alleviate traffic congestion and reduce travel times. They are trying to create a viable alternative to ground-based transportation, especially in densely populated areas. Archer's approach centers around developing a fully electric aircraft that can take off and land vertically, similar to a helicopter, but with the advantages of electric propulsion.

The Technology Behind Archer's eVTOL Aircraft

Now, let's talk about the fun part: the technology. Archer's eVTOL aircraft are designed to be fully electric, which means zero emissions during flight. This is a huge win for the environment and aligns with the growing demand for sustainable transportation solutions. The aircraft features a number of innovative technologies, including distributed electric propulsion, which provides enhanced safety and efficiency. This design distributes the propulsion across multiple motors, increasing redundancy and improving performance. Archer's eVTOL aircraft will be significantly quieter than traditional helicopters, reducing noise pollution in urban areas. This is a crucial factor for gaining community acceptance and integrating these aircraft into city life. The combination of electric propulsion and advanced aerodynamic design contributes to lower operating costs compared to conventional aircraft.

Design and Features

Archer's aircraft boast a sleek and modern design, with a focus on passenger comfort and safety. The cabin is designed to accommodate multiple passengers, with spacious seating and panoramic views. The aircraft features advanced flight control systems and safety features, ensuring a secure and reliable travel experience. They are built to comply with the highest safety standards set by aviation authorities, such as the FAA (Federal Aviation Administration). Archer's design incorporates a combination of fixed wings and tilting rotors, allowing for efficient vertical takeoff and landing, as well as high-speed cruise flight. The aircraft's design has been optimized for aerodynamic efficiency, which will increase the range and reduce energy consumption. Archer's eVTOL aircraft incorporate advanced materials and manufacturing techniques to minimize weight and maximize performance. Challenges and Future Developments

Of course, there are always challenges. The eVTOL industry, including Archer, faces several hurdles, from regulatory approvals to developing the necessary infrastructure. Gaining certification from aviation authorities, such as the FAA, is a complex process that requires extensive testing and validation. Building the infrastructure needed to support eVTOL operations, like vertiports and charging stations, is a major undertaking. Public acceptance and addressing concerns about noise and safety are also crucial. Archer is actively working to overcome these challenges and is making significant progress. They have assembled a strong team of experts to navigate the regulatory landscape and are collaborating with cities and other stakeholders to develop the necessary infrastructure.
